Foundation Drain Replacement in Tuscaloosa, AL

Foundation drain replacement involves removing and installing new drainage systems designed to direct water away from a building’s foundation. This service is commonly requested for homes experiencing basement or crawl space moisture issues, foundation cracking, or water pooling around the property. Projects typically cover replacing aging or damaged drain tiles, installing new perforated pipes, and ensuring proper grading and drainage to prevent water infiltration and structural damage. Property owners often want to understand the scope of excavation, the materials used, and how the new drainage system will improve water management around their home.

Before requesting foundation drain replacement, property owners should consider the current condition of their existing drainage system and any signs of water intrusion or foundation movement. It’s important to evaluate whether the project involves partial or full replacement, and to understand the impact of excavation on landscaping or driveways. Clarifying the expected lifespan of the new drainage setup and any necessary preparations can help ensure the project meets long-term needs for a dry, stable foundation.

Foundation Drain Replacement Questions

What is a foundation drain replacement? It involves removing and installing new drainage systems to direct water away from the foundation, helping prevent water damage and basement flooding.

When should a foundation drain be replaced? Replacement is recommended when existing drains are clogged, damaged, or no longer effectively manage water flow around the foundation.

What types of foundation drain systems are commonly used? Common options include interior and exterior drain tile systems designed to collect and redirect water away from the foundation.

How does a foundation drain replacement benefit property owners? It improves soil drainage, reduces water pressure on the foundation, and helps maintain the structural integrity of the property.
